Design Characteristics of Jack Base
● Structure of the Jack Base
The jack base is a fundamental part of the scaffolding setup. It is typically constructed with a robust threaded rod and a base plate, which provides a stable foundation for the scaffolding. The threading on the rod allows for precise height adjustments, which is crucial in ensuring that scaffolding is level, even on uneven ground. Functionality of Jack Base in Scaffolding
● Role in Height Adjustment
The primary function of a scaffolding jack base is to facilitate height adjustment. This feature is vital when dealing with uneven or sloped surfaces, as it allows each scaffolding leg to be independently adjusted to create a level working surface.
● Importance for Stability and Leveling
Beyond height adjustment, the scaffolding jack base is essential for the overall stability of the scaffolding system. A well-manufactured jack base ensures that the entire scaffolding structure remains secure, reducing the risk of accidents and ensuring worker safety.
Understanding the U-Head Design
● Unique U-Shape Configuration
The U-head, distinct due to its U-shaped design, is specifically crafted to hold and support horizontal beams or ledgers in scaffolding systems. Its unique shape allows it to cradle these beams securely, providing additional support and structural integrity.
● Components and Materials Used
Similar to the jack base, U-heads are predominantly made from galvanised steel. This choice of material ensures that they can withstand substantial loads and resist corrosion. Scaffolding U-heads must meet strict quality standards to ensure they perform effectively in diverse conditions.
Functionality of U-Heads in Scaffolding
● Role in Supporting Horizontal Ledgers
The U-head's principal function is to support horizontal ledgers. Its design allows it to integrate seamlessly with vertical posts, distributing the weight of the platforms and any additional load evenly. This role is critical in ensuring the stability and safety of the scaffolding structure.
● Integration with Vertical Posts
In addition to supporting horizontal components, U-heads are designed to integrate smoothly with the vertical posts of the scaffolding. This integration ensures that the entire system functions as a cohesive unit, enhancing both its stability and safety.

Applications of Jack Base in Scaffolding
● Types of Scaffolding Systems Utilized
Scaffolding jack bases are used in a variety of scaffolding systems, including ringlock, cuplock, and kwikstage systems. These bases are essential for providing a stable and adjustable foundation, especially on uneven terrain.
● Site-Specific Use Cases
On construction sites where the ground is uneven, or the foundation is irregular, the use of a jack base is indispensable. It allows for precise adjustments that keep the scaffolding straight and secure, making it an invaluable tool for site managers and builders.
Applications of U-Head in Scaffolding
● Versatility Across Scaffolding Systems
U-heads are versatile components that can be employed across many scaffolding systems, from traditional tube and coupler setups to more advanced systems like kwikstage. They provide the necessary support for horizontal members, ensuring the structural integrity of the scaffolding.
● Common Scenarios for Use
U-heads are commonly used in scenarios where significant horizontal loads are present. This includes supporting substantial platform weights or when additional materials need to be stored on scaffolding levels, making the U-head a crucial element in these situations.
